A lot of FSes would be useless in the labyrinth.

That's exactly why I don't like created stages with "ceilings."
An enclosed arena is fun since it will provide a long match, if one knows how to position one's character.
Sonic, for example, would not have been able to withstand that kind of damage had it not been for the protective walls.
Moreover, I have to say that Snake's FS would be obviously useful (and wicked) in a labyrinthine map. (like shotting fish in a barrel)
